tep into the quiet hush of an alpine morning with “Snowfall in the Eucalypts”, a fine landscape art print by Australian photographer Robert Vine.

Captured at Mount Selwyn in the Snowy Mountains, this evocative scene reveals the subtle power of nature at rest. A blanket of fresh snow softens every branch, coating the twisted trunks of snow gums and mountain shrubs in a delicate glaze of frost. The mist rolls gently through the hills, dissolving into a pale winter sky that fades almost imperceptibly from silver to white.

There is no movement here — only stillness. The landscape seems to hold its breath, suspended between seasons. Vine’s masterful use of contrast and composition draws your eye along a faint winding path through the trees, hinting at solitude and quiet discovery. The limited palette of greys and whites gives the image a painterly, minimalist quality — perfect for modern interiors where subtle tones and natural textures reign.

Rob's Thoughts

"I wasn't expecting to find such stark beauty in the Australian Alps, in all my previous trips I had found the environment to be thriving beneath the layer of snow but this place, at this time was different. Finding this vantage point across a valley from these trees I felt the temperature drop and the wind pick up. The scene was stark but a reminder that beauty can come from struggle against the elements. I felt that this was a perfect description of my life at that time, I was struggling to balance the all the elements of my life but, there was beauty in my life too."
